Community Event - Chatham - 'A Yuletide Christmas' Benefit for Salvation Army

Submitted by Anonymous (not verified) on
1574535600 1574558100

11th Annual historic Christmas show. Saturday November 23rd,  2:00 p.m. and 7:00 p.m. at the Salvation Army Citadel, 46 Orangewood Blvd. in Chatham  Join us for old-fashioned storytelling and carol singing in a candle lit setting, in this benefit show for the Salvation Army’s food programs across Chatham-Kent.

This year’s show is set during the Christmas season of 1879. Queen Victoria is still on the throne, Canada is more than a decade old, and in Kent County, a Chatham grandfather has gathered with his friends and family for a bit of cheer.  Tales of Christmases Past are shared, and old carols ring out once again. Together, we’ll brave an early winter storm to travel down the Thames towards ‘Old Sandwich Town’, where we’ll learn a story from the heart of the forest that lead to Canada’s First Christmas Carol!   Back in  town, Grandmother will meet Grand-mere and share a laugh about making ‘A Potato Pie for Christmas’ .  The evening will finish with a story about the Yule Log, a fancy cake with an ancient past and how a tradition handed down for generations nearly lead to a disaster on Christmas eve!

If you’d like to practice, this year’s songs will include Tom Jackson’s version of ‘The Huron Carol’, ‘Sing we now of Christmas’, and of course, ‘Jingle Bells’!  Song books are provided for those that wish to sing along. 

Admission is by free-will offering only.  Performances are at 2:00 p.m. and 7:00 p.m., Saturday November 23rd, at the Salvation Army Citadel, 46 Orangewood Blvd. in Chatham.  There is plenty of free parking and the site is Accessible.  While the show is family friendly, there are some strong themes.

Guests are encouraged to bring non-perishable food items for a chance to win great prizes that have been donated by area merchants.
